Action item (PM-creek-reindex): Add a guard so the nightly search reindex on Searchloft aborts if the source snapshot is older than 12 hours. Reviewer: confirm the abort path emits a metric and skips index swap. Acceptance criteria and the snapshot freshness spec are captured on the internal page below.

wiki page, yaguf-bawig: https://jira.norvacorp.internal/browse/display/view/b5a061abb09d

- [ ] **Step 7: Breaker override escrow.** After sealing the signing keys for the Tallgrove upstream API circuit breaker, confirm the support team can force the breaker open during a full outage. The override bundle lives in the sealed escrow drawer and is useless without its unlock phrase. Two ceremony witnesses must initial this step before proceeding. The escrow bundle is decrypted with the recovery passphrase that follows.

vault phrase of kahip-kahop = holath-quenmir

Heads of department: the new subscription tier for the Lumenfold platform, working name Summit, is spec-complete and priced, pending legal review of the usage terms. Launch window holds at early next quarter; billing integration with the Tarnley system is the long pole. Penhall takes ownership of go-to-market from next week; Ashgrove remains available for two weeks of transition. Department leads should freeze tier-related feature requests until the launch board meets. Strategic context is set out in the confidential note below.

board note of kageg-bahof: The renewal with Holwynax Holdings closes at $2 million a year, 5 percent below the last contract. Project Ulaath slips by two quarters because of the supplier delay.

Ticket: PIX-4417 — Expired credentials blocking leak diagnostics

The Snapframe image cache has a confirmed memory leak in thumbnail eviction, but plugin authors can't pull heap snapshots because the diagnostics credential expired last Friday. Leak repro steps are in the linked doc. A replacement key has been issued; rotate your plugin configs within 48 hours. New key for the diagnostics endpoint follows.

service key, yadug-bajog: zpat3_pou